Performance and Specifications of the 2025 Audi S5
The 2025 Audi S5 delivers impressive 0-100 km/h acceleration with its 367 HP output. This model features a turbocharged V6 engine, enhanced by a mild-hybrid system.
The 2025 Audi S5 showcases its performance prowess with a powerful output of 367 horsepower, delivered by a 3.0-liter turbocharged V6 engine enhanced by a mild-hybrid system. This setup not only contributes to the car's impressive acceleration but also enhances its efficiency. The S5 is equipped with a 7-speed dual-clutch automatic transmission, providing quick shifts and seamless power delivery.
In a recent acceleration test, the 2025 Audi S5 achieved a remarkable 0-100 km/h time of just 4.5 seconds. The launch control feature provides a strong initial push, ensuring that the car takes off smoothly and swiftly. From a standstill, the Audi S5 showcases its capabilities, offering a thrilling experience as it accelerates through mid-range speeds with confidence.
As the S5 pushes towards higher speeds, it maintains excellent stability, demonstrating the benefits of its quattro all-wheel-drive system. The car reaches a top speed of 250 km/h, allowing it to perform competitively in the premium midsize segment.
